Home's Review of INFORCE Gen 3 - WMLx 1100 Lumens Weapon Light
The Ultimate Home Defense Light - Ultra-Lightweight & Zero Snag Hazards.
If you are setting up a rifle or PCC for home defense, the INFORCE Gen 3 WMLx is hands-down the best value you will find on OpticsPlanet. I recently bought this specifically for an indoor/close-quarters setup, and it absolutely dominates the competition in this price bracket.
Why this is the perfect home defense light:
Insanely Lightweight: Weighing in at roughly 4.9 ounces with the two CR123A batteries installed, you won’t even notice it on the end of your rail. When you are clearing a house or holding a doorway, a heavy front end causes rapid arm fatigue. The glass-reinforced nylon polymer body solves that completely without sacrificing durability.
Blinding Output: The Gen 3 upgrade is a massive leap forward. At 1,100 lumens and 25,000 candela, it provides an intensely bright hotspot that reaches out past 175 yards but still has enough flood to light up a hallway or living room. It is overwhelmingly bright to an intruder but provides fantastic peripheral vision for you.
Zero Cable Management (The Best Feature): The ergonomic, angled rear activation button is the real star here. You don’t need to buy a $60 tape switch, deal with zip-ties, or worry about exposed wires snagging on door frames or gear in the middle of the night. You just C-clamp your rail, and your thumb rests naturally on the pad.
Value: For under $150, you are getting a fully integrated system (mount and switch included) that is waterproof to 66 feet, has a physical lockout safety switch, and pushes 1,100 lumens. To get this level of output and ergonomic integration from other major brands, you are easily spending over $300.
